The Upper Willamette Soil and Water Conservation District (UWSWCD) is hiring a Fiscal Officer to join its District team. This position is responsible for the fiscal and human resource operations of the district. The position will be responsible for all aspects of the financial operations of the district including fund accounting, budgeting, local budget law, and financial reporting. Human resource responsibility includes overseeing the districts benefit plans and ensuring that personnel policies are in alignment with current law. Additionally, this position will develop a grant management system. The district provides all employees a generous benefit package.
